Nicaraguan Election Chief Banned From Entering US for Corruption - State Dept.

WASHINGTON (Pakistan Point News / Sputnik - 13th December, 2018) Nicaragua's top election official has been designated and banned from entering the United States due to alleged involvement in corruption, the State Department said in press release on Wednesday.

"Due to his involvement in significant corruption, the Department is publicly designating the President of Nicaragua's Supreme Electoral Council, Roberto Jose Rivas Reyes," the release said. "In cases where the Secretary of State has credible information that foreign officials have been involved in significant corruption... those individuals and their immediate family members are ineligible for entry into the United States.

"

The State Department also barred Rivas' spouse, Ileana Patricia Lacayo Delgado de Rivas, from travel to the United States, the release added.

Last December the US government imposed Magnitsky Act sanctions on Rivas for perpetuating electoral fraud and undermining the country's electoral institutions.

Washington has imposed sanctions on a number of Nicaraguan officials since the outbreak of anti-government protests last spring and a subsequent crackdown by security forces, in which nearly 300 people have died.
